The Process And Benefits Of Using A Machine A Lyophilisé

A machine a lyophilisé, also known as a freeze dryer, is a sophisticated piece of equipment used in many industries for various applications. The process of lyophilisation involves freezing a product and then removing the ice through sublimation, resulting in a dry and stable final product. This method is commonly used in the food, pharmaceutical, and biotechnology industries to preserve sensitive materials and extend their shelf life. In this article, we will explore how a machine a lyophilisé works and its benefits in different fields.

The operation of a machine a lyophilisé can be broken down into several steps. Firstly, the product is placed on trays or shelves inside the freeze dryer chamber. The temperature is then lowered to freezing levels, causing the water in the product to freeze. Next, a vacuum pump removes the air pressure within the chamber, causing the frozen water to sublimate directly from solid to gas without passing through the liquid phase. This process dehydrates the product, leaving behind a dry and stable material.

One of the main benefits of using a machine a lyophilisé is its ability to preserve sensitive materials. Many products, such as pharmaceuticals, enzymes, and vaccines, are sensitive to heat and moisture and can degrade quickly if not properly preserved. By freeze-drying these materials, they can be stored for extended periods without losing their potency or effectiveness. This is particularly important in the pharmaceutical industry, where the stability of drugs and vaccines is crucial for their efficacy.

Another advantage of using a machine a lyophilisé is the extended shelf life it provides to products. Freeze-dried materials have a significantly longer shelf life compared to their fresh or liquid counterparts. This is because the removal of water from the product prevents microbial growth and chemical reactions that can cause degradation. As a result, companies can store their products for longer periods without the need for refrigeration or other special storage conditions, saving both time and money.

In the food industry, a machine a lyophilisé is commonly used to preserve perishable goods such as fruits, vegetables, and meat. Freeze-drying these products not only extends their shelf life but also retains their taste, texture, and nutritional value. Freeze-dried foods are lightweight, easy to transport, and require minimal storage space, making them ideal for camping, hiking, and emergency preparedness. Additionally, freeze-dried foods can be rehydrated quickly by adding water, making them convenient and versatile for consumers.

In the biotechnology industry, a machine a lyophilisé is used to preserve and transport biological samples, cell cultures, and reagents. Freeze-drying these materials allows researchers to store and ship them at room temperature without the need for refrigeration or special handling. This is particularly beneficial for international collaborations and field research where access to cold storage facilities may be limited. Furthermore, freeze-dried reagents and samples can be reconstituted easily when needed, reducing wastage and saving time in the laboratory.
